WebbThe only nouns that commonly take an ’s in the plural are (1) abbreviations with more than one period and (2) single letters. M.B.A.’s, R.N.’s x’s and y’s A’s and B’s Otherwise, acronyms, hyphenated coinages, and numbers used as nouns (either spelled out or as numerals) generally add s (or es) alone to form the plural. WebbThe plural form of this abbreviation is Mss. or Mses., and the title Miss , used traditionally for an unmarried girl or woman, is simply pluralized as Misses. In recent years, the honorific Mx. has come to be used as a courtesy title that gives no reference to a person’s gender. Webb2 apr. 2024 · To form the plural of an acronym or other abbreviation, simply add an s. No apostrophe is necessary. ATM s, MBA s, PhD s, OTP s, URL s, PC s, DVD s, LAN s, SSN s, …

WebbYou make the plural and the possessive in the usual way for acronyms. For example: I had a VCR. The VCR's power button was broken. I bought another VCR, so I had two VCRs. Then the second one's channel selector button broke, …
